Zelensky's Demilitarized Zone Proposal for Ukraine Peace
Update: 2025-12-24
Description
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ky proposes a demilitarized zone in eastern Ukraine, following talks with US officials. The plan, part of a twenty-point peace proposal, includes a sixty-day freeze on front lines for voting and Russian pullouts from certain areas. However, major disagreements persist over the Donbas region and the Zaporizhzhia Nuclear Power Plant. Zelensky suggests the Donbas become a demilitarized or free economic zone, monitored by international forces. Russia continues attacks on cities and power grids, causing deaths and injuries. The final decision rests with the Ukrainian people, as Zelensky keeps hope alive for a balanced peace.
